header {
	background:#2c3e50;
	color:#fff;
}
/* comentarios      */
.main {
	background:#f2f2f2;
}

.color1 {
	background: #34495e;
	color:#fff;
}

aside {
	background:#c0392b;
	color:#fff;
}

footer {
	background:#16a085;
	color:#fff;
}
body {
/*	font-family: 'Asap', sans-serif; */
	font-family: sans-serif;	
}
ibody {
	background: #34495e;
	margin: 30px auto;
	width: 500px;
}
